The gap in maternity care is real. Between appointments, most women navigate symptoms, questions and uncertainty without clinical support. Macha sits in that space, building a continuous picture of your health so that when you do see your midwife, you arrive informed and ready.

Personalised digital medicine is changing how people experience healthcare. Macha is part of that shift. Built with NHS midwives and grounded in NICE and NHS guidelines, it gives every woman the knowledge to understand her own pregnancy, ask the right questions and get the best from the care she receives.
